Strategies for Effective Communication and Coordination
Effective communication and coordination are the cornerstones of successful collaboration between community organizations. Establishing clear and consistent channels of communication ensures that all stakeholders are aligned, informed, and engaged. Regular meetings, both in-person and virtual, create opportunities for open dialogue, fostering an environment where ideas can be shared freely. Additionally, utilizing collaborative tools like shared documents, project management software, and communication platforms ensures everyone has access to the latest information and updates.
When it comes to coordinating efforts, setting clear goals and objectives is essential. Organizations should define their roles and responsibilities, creating a structured framework that prevents overlap or gaps in service delivery. Regularly scheduled check-ins allow for progress tracking, problem-solving, and course correction when needed. Engaging in mutual respect and understanding, even in the face of differing opinions or priorities, helps maintain a cohesive team spirit, making it easier to navigate challenges together.
